<p>Performing a little bit of thread necromancy since I ran across this and wanted anyone who ran across it in the future to know that, as of Isadora 4, the Button Control has Control Properties for the color of the button in its on and off states:</p>
<p><img src="/assets/uploads/files/1741286023475-screen-shot-2025-03-06-at-7.32.05-pm.png" style="cursor:pointer" /></p><p>The method of using a picture is still totally viable, and can be nicer if you want to include a fancier-looking button designed in Photoshop. Also, it's worth noting that you can use images that have alpha and the alpha will be transparent on the button in the Control Panel and you can make some pretty neat buttons that way.</p>]]></description><link>https://community.troikatronix.com/post/55962</link><guid isPermaLink="true">https://community.troikatronix.com/post/55962</guid><dc:creator><![CDATA[Woland]]></dc:creator><pubDate>Thu, 06 Mar 2025 18:36:27 GMT</pubDate></item><item><title><![CDATA[Reply to [ANSWERED] Control panel buttons color change programmatically? on Fri, 29 Mar 2024 04:21:56 GMT]]></title><description><![CDATA[<p><a class="plugin-mentions-user plugin-mentions-a" href="https://community.troikatronix.com/uid/984">@jandraka</a></p><p>Perfect!
